What Are Vintage Drinking Cups?
Vintage drinking cups are classic, often handcrafted, vessels made from materials like porcelain, glass, or metal. They were popularized in earlier eras and are now treasured for their aesthetic and historical value. Some are simple yet elegant, while others boast ornate patterns and delicate craftsmanship.

Caring for Your Vintage Drinking Cups
- Gentle Cleaning:
Wash by hand with mild soap and avoid abrasive scrubbers to preserve their design. - Proper Storage:
Store cups in a secure place to prevent chips or cracks. Use padded dividers for delicate pieces. - Avoid Extreme Temperatures:
Don’t expose cups to sudden temperature changes, which can damage their material.
